So I've been trying to search the web for answers without succes so I thought I'll try my luck here.

In January 2015 I made a wallet at blockchain.info and bought a bit of bitcoin for fun. I forgot about it but recently discovered bitcoin's rise etc and wanted to access my wallet. Now I found a note which meets all the criteria of being a wallet ID (string with lowercase letters, numbers and hyphens(-)). So I'm 90% sure this was my wallet ID but when I try to log in I get the message 'unknow wallet identifier'.

Now my question is: could it be possible the wallet ID changed when the blockchain wallet HD replaced the old wallet? Or is it more likey I just mispelled my wallet ID at the time.

I forgot which email I used for the account. Tried all my email adresses to recover wallet ID but none are receiving anything. Also, I haven't found my recovery phrase (yet).

If anyone has any info or tips I would be very greatful!

If you are using the same internet provider you were using at that time then just get your IP address and send it to support and ask them to provide the wallet ID associated with that IP.

In case if you changed your ISP then email your previous ISP and ask them the IP address you were using at that time. but before doing all that make sure you have your password otherwise, it will be waste of time. good luck
